Spoti-fiasco... Spotify’s getting heat for "The Joe Rogan Experience," aka: the world's largest pod. In December, Rogan interviewed Covid vaccine critic Dr. Robert Malone. Cue: 270 medical experts called on Spotify to curb misinfo on its platform. Then, Neil Young demanded that Spotify remove his tunes or remove Rogan — Spotify nixed Young. The streamer reportedly paid $100M to make JRE Spotify-exclusive, as pods play a growing role in its growth (FYI: it reports on Wednesday). As its pod biz booms, Spotify could face more pressure to define its moderation policies.

Yellow Cab meets Jetsons... Electric flying taxis (think: futuristic helicopters) are taking off. Boeing-backed startup Wisk just sealed a deal with Blade’s urban mobility network to fly autonomous taxis in the US. Earlier this month, Toyota-backed Joby said its prototype completed a high-speed flight. ETA for passenger service: 2024. Houston, LA, and Orlando have announced plans to establish air taxi “skyports.” But first, flying taxis need the FAA’s greenlight to fly commercially. And companies still face several hurdles — from air traffic control challenges, to public support.
